Escape The Fate Release Video For ‘Remember Every Scar’

Escape the Fate have released a video for ‘Remember Every Scar’, taken from their recent, fifth studio album, ‘Hate Me’, released last Autumn. After a lengthy US tour, the band will be back on these shores to perform at Download on June 11th.

UK planning law amended to help protect music venues

The Music Venue Trust, designed to protect the UK live music network, has reported agreed changes to the UK planning law legislation that helps to support the continued success of live music venues. From the 6th April 2016 planning authorities will be mandated to consider noise impact from existing businesses
